Vettel sure Ferrari can pressure Hamilton
– Sebastian Vettel hopes he and Ferrari team-mate Kimi Räikkönen can use the advantage of two cars at the sharp end of the grid to put pole-sitter Lewis Hamilton under pressure at the British Grand Prix.Hamilton swept to pole position for his home race at Silverstone, with a half second buffer back to Räikkönen, as Vettel set the third best time.Valtteri Bottas, meanwhile, qualified only fourth, and will drop to ninth on the grid due to a gearbox penalty, leaving Hamilton on his own up front against the Ferrari pair."There's always an opportunity, so we'll see," title leader Vettel said on his prospects of overhauling Hamilton."The target is to put him under...
